Our good friend Victoria Justice returns to the YH Studio to scoop us on her role in MTV's drama/mystery/thriller, "Eye Candy", which is a definite departure from her previous work with Nickelodeon! She gives us some background on the show, which is produced by the 'Paranormal Activity' team and based on a book by R.L. Stine, including how the city in which it takes place, New York, is like another character on the show. She also tells us which episode was her favorite to film, plus she reveals which fashion, food, cars, candy, and men she considers "eye candy"!

And it's huge for MTV as well. This is like a, you know, a new thing. Obviously, they have the Teen Wolfs and stuff like that, but
Right. That's a super natural side. This is, this is just a thriller side. So it's great. It kind of also has, um, some CSI elements to the show as well. Because, you know, in the first couple episodes, it's all about like the serial killer and I'm trying to find out who this person is and it's this game of like cat and mouse. And that continues out throughout the whole season, but it also then shifts to like my character joins the cyber crimes unit. Right. And so I'm trying to figure out like other, um, crimes as well. And yeah, it's really, it's like fun and sexy and dark and twisted.
Right. And you are, you are Lindy, this cyber hacker. Georgie's going now. Georgie's scared. Georgie's like, I like Victoria when she wasn't doing shows like this. She can't deal with it. And it's the uh, producers of paranormal activity as well. So a good bunch of people behind it.
Oh, they're awesome. And then also it's based on a book by R. L. Stine.

And you mentioned it's filmed in New York. How was that? So you've spent a lot of time there then, yeah?
Yeah. Filming in New York was great and it's really, I think it's great for the show because it's, um, New York is kind of like a character in the show and we utilized it and and there are so many cool locations and I feel like the show's filmed so beautifully. Thanks to our DP, um, Dave Daniels who's amazing.
Is there a, uh, episode in particular that you'd uh, you'd say is one of your favorites or is the most challenging to film that you'd say for people should look out for?
There is an episode coming up that we filmed in an abandoned, um, an abandoned ship. And that was, that was really crazy to film. Um, because also like if you had to like go pee, you had to like walk like a mile to get back to like where, um, base camp was. Like there was nothing on the ship.
